In Jaipur, the communal tension-144th clause applied, injuring a total of 24 including 9 police

Jaipur, Ta. Wednesday 14th August 2019

The 144th clause was implemented in Rajasthan's capital Jaipur on Monday night, triggering communal tensions and violent incidents. A total of 24 people, including nine policemen, were injured in the violent incidents.

According to the police, the incident took place on Monday night from 14th Monday night at Galata Gate, Ramganj, Subhash Chowk, Manik Chowk, Brahmapuri, Kotwali, Sanjay Circle, Nahargarh, Shastrinagar, Bhatta Basti, Adarsh ​​Nagar, Moti Dungari, Lal Kothi, Transport Nagar and Jawahar Nagar.

Internet service was also shut down on Wednesday night in more than ten areas. According to the information provided by the police, the collision broke out when one of the comm people was jamming the Delhi highway near Galta Gate.

Meanwhile, passengers of the bus were injured when someone was throwing stones at a bus coming from Haridwar. Meanwhile, rumors spread that people from both comms came face to face and attacked each other. More than half a dozen cars were smashed.
